臭氧——浮滤池工艺强化处理引黄水库水中有机物的试验研究 |

摘 要: | 分别采用预臭氧-浮滤池工艺和臭氧气浮-浮滤池工艺对鹊山水库水进行了试验研究.预臭氧-浮滤池工艺试验结果表明,臭氧预处理对浊度去除影响不大;臭氧预氧化对UV<,254>的去除效率很高,平均去除率为76.47%,经气浮、活性炭过滤之后,总去除率可达到100%;臭氧预氧化对COD<,Mn>有一定的去除效果,总去除率较无臭氧预处理平均提高7.0%,出水平均值降至1.87 mg/L.臭氧气浮-浮滤池工艺试验表明,臭氧气浮对浊度去除影响不大,臭氧的强氧化性主要表现在对UV254的去除上,其平均去除率比浮滤池工艺提高了9.8%.

Experiments of ozone - floating filter for the enhanced treatment of organic compounds in reservoir water derived from the Yellow River |

Abstract: | Experiments were conducted with preozonation-floating filter and ozone-DAF-floating filter for treatment of water from Queshan Reservoir.The results of preozonation-floating filter showed that preozonation had a little efficiency on turbidity removal,but it had high removal efficiency on UV254 with the average removal rate of 76.47%,and the total removal rate could be 100% after DAF and activated carbon filtration.Preozonation had some impact on CODMn removal,and the removal rate increased by 7.0%,comparing... |
